Bella Candles beautiful candles but shady service

Now I'm not a fan of putting a company down unless they have truly bad service or I have had beyond a bad experience with them. EVEN though they have beautiful candles beware how they bill and ship. I had been getting emails from them for a few months and back in June they had an offer of try one of 3 candles for just a $1 shipping. I thought it was a great treat to see if I liked them because I love candles as long as they have a decent scent and even more I love getting good surprises. As a mom of 3 teenage daughters the fact they had jewelry inside made it even better because not only could I make my house smell nice I could if I did not like the item or it did not fit I had 3 other people I could give it to. So on June 10th I ordered the Paris candle which had a ring in it plus had the added benefit of being both a moisturizer and a massage oil which would help relax after a long day. I am hoping for the glowing skin result as I think I have too much redness in my face and I do not like feeling like I look like a circus clown. This peel by Dr Song contains 20% salicylic acid. At a high concentration level, salicylic acid acts as a peeling agent dissolving the top layer of the epidermis and resurfaces the skin. This results in a smoother and more glowing complexion. Salicylic Acid is a beta-hydroxy acid (BHA). It is a highly effective peeling agent that is an oil reducer and pore cleanser. Salicylic acid is ideal for oily and acne prone skin.
